Area of Science:

  • Neuroscience
  • Behavioral Neuroscience
  • Cognitive Science

Background:

  • Hippocampus-dependent spatial learning is crucial for navigation.
  • Traditional methods like the Morris water maze (MWM) have limitations.
  • The active place avoidance (APA) task provides a novel approach.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To provide a detailed protocol for the active place avoidance (APA) task.
  • To highlight the versatility and advantages of the APA task.
  • To describe data collection and analysis for the APA task.

Main Methods:

  • Mice navigate a rotating arena with spatial cues.
  • Animals must avoid a stationary shock zone.
  • The APA task allows for adjustable parameters and longitudinal studies.

Main Results:

  • The APA task is adaptable for various mouse strains and conditions.
  • It is suitable for aged mice and disease models like Alzheimer's.
  • The task can accommodate animals with motor or neural impairments.

Conclusions:

  • The APA task is a flexible and powerful tool for spatial learning research.
  • It offers advantages over traditional methods for specific research questions.
  • This protocol facilitates the successful implementation of the APA task.
